閱讀屋>面試> cvte java面試題

cvte java面試題

cvte java面試題

答案:B

答案:B

答案:B

答案:A

答案:B

答案:C

D

答案:A

D

2、問答題,每題6分。

Exc0 caught

答案:DCBB 類D、C是靜態方法,直接呼叫了,類A、B中的是普通方法,父類方法被子類方法過載,所以輸出B

答案:x=0,y=0 main中new B()時,A先載入,A的構造方法中呼叫printFields(),呼叫了子類的printFields()方法(父類呼叫子類方法),System.out.println 執行,輸出int 型別的x、y,此時由於B類構造方法還沒執行,x也還沒有被賦值,就輸出了int型別的預設值0

答案:3 注意:static靜態塊只是載入執行了一次,所以是3

答案:使用group by和having來實現

3、設計題

答題思路:使系統符合開閉原則,為輸入提供一個公共介面,介面中有與輸入相關的方法,具體的輸入實現該介面。

4、設計題

答題思路:設計模式中的`單例模式。寫出一個單例模式。當然,如果能夠說明單例模式中的懶漢式、餓漢式、以及透過共享的方式來建立單例物件、以及在維持這個單例物件需要消耗大量的資源時,各種不同的情況,那是最好的。

5、程式程式碼實現

說明:就是寫程式碼實現一個長度為n的字串的全序列,如“ABC”的全排序為ABC,ACB,BCA,BAC,CBA,CAB。


[cvte java面試題]相關文章:

1.cvte java面試題

2.2014山東省徵集志願

【cvte java面試題】相關文章: